Seasonal SEO Tips to Drive Traffic Over the Holidays

The holiday season is a crucial time for businesses, with consumers eager to shop and seek out information. To capitalise on this opportunity, you need a robust SEO strategy that aligns with seasonal trends. Here are essential tips to optimise your website and drive traffic during the holidays.

1. Update Your Keywords

As the holidays approach, consumer intent shifts dramatically. People are searching for gifts, festive recipes, holiday travel tips, and more. Conduct keyword research to identify seasonal phrases that align with your business. Use tools like Google Keyword Planner, SEMrush, or Ahrefs to discover trending keywords. Incorporate these keywords naturally into your website content, product descriptions, and blog posts to improve your chances of ranking higher in search results.

2. Optimise for Local Searches

Local SEO becomes increasingly important during the holiday season as shoppers look for nearby stores and services. Ensure your Google My Business profile is up-to-date with your business hours, location, and holiday offerings. Encourage customer reviews to enhance your visibility in local searches. Consider creating localised content that speaks to your community, such as holiday events or promotions. This strategy will not only drive traffic but also foster community engagement.

3. Create Festive Content

Content marketing is a powerful way to attract holiday traffic. Develop blog posts, videos, and infographics that resonate with holiday themes. For example, if you sell home goods, create guides on holiday decorating or gift ideas. If you’re in the food industry, share festive recipes or party planning tips. Optimise this content with seasonal keywords and promote it through social media channels to reach a wider audience.

4. Leverage Social Media

During the holiday season, consumers are highly active on social media platforms. Use these channels to promote your seasonal content and offers. Create eye-catching posts that highlight your holiday specials, and use relevant hashtags to expand your reach. Consider running holiday-themed contests or giveaways to engage your audience and encourage shares, which can drive traffic back to your website.

5. Improve Page Load Speed

With increased holiday traffic, it’s vital to ensure your website performs optimally. A slow-loading site can lead to high bounce rates and lost sales. Optimise images, enable browser caching, and minimise JavaScript to enhance page speed. Use tools like Google PageSpeed Insights to analyse your site and implement necessary improvements. A faster site not only improves user experience but also boosts your SEO rankings.

6. Implement Schema Markup

Schema markup helps search engines understand your content better, which can improve your visibility in search results. For the holiday season, consider implementing schema for products, reviews, and events. This structured data can enhance your search listings with rich snippets, making your links more appealing and increasing click-through rates.

7. Monitor and Adjust Your Strategy

Finally, monitor your website’s performance throughout the holiday season. Use tools like Google Analytics to track traffic sources, user behavior, and conversion rates. If you notice any trends or patterns, be ready to adjust your SEO strategy accordingly. Flexibility is key during the holiday rush, so make data-driven decisions to maximise your results.

The holiday season presents a unique opportunity to boost traffic and sales through effective SEO strategies. By updating your keywords, optimising for local searches, creating engaging content, leveraging social media, improving your site’s performance, implementing schema markup, and continuously monitoring your efforts, you can position your business for success this holiday season.
